Add Subtotals of Hours Worked by Employee in Field Ticket Time Entry.

We would like to see daily/weekly subtotals of hours worked, by employee, added to the Time Entry section of the Field Ticket. (Similar to the employee totals shown in the Grid Timecard.) If separate totals could be displayed based on the Earnings Type (Straight Time, Overtime, Double Time, etc.), that would be ideal. We feel this would save time for Job Superintendents, eliminating the need to manually total the hours worked, and would make it much easier to spot any potential omitted/missed time.
